Ethereum continues to perform strongly in institutional capital flows
The capital flows of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s remain key market indicators.
On July 8, the Bitcoin ETF recorded a net outflow of US$84.86 million, indicating that institutional investors remain cautious. At the same time, the spot Ethereum ETF attracted a net inflow of US$70.48 million, maintaining a net inflow of funds for five consecutive trading days.
The contrast between the two ETFs \'capital flows suggests that institutional capital is more interested in Ethereum than Bitcoin in the short term. U.S. spot bitcoin exchange-traded funds (ETFs) returned to negative territory on July 8, with a net outflow of US$84.86 million that day, following signs of improving investor sentiment at the beginning of the week. The latest data shows that institutional demand for Bitcoin remains unstable, and investors continue to respond to widespread macroeconomic uncertainties and fluctuations in the crypto market.
While Bitcoin products lost funds, the spot Ethereum ETF attracted a net inflow of US$70.48 million, extending the momentum of capital inflows to five consecutive trading days. This continued inflow of funds suggests that even though Bitcoin funds are still under intermittent selling pressure, institutional interest in Ethereum has risen again.
The latest ETF fund flow data comes after Bitcoin investment products have just gone through a difficult period. Just last week, the weekly net outflow of spot Bitcoin ETF exceeded $526 million, ending one of the weakest periods of the year before briefly recovering due to several days of inflows. However, Wednesday\'s outflows showed that investors remain cautious and have not yet fully returned to the market.
Ethereum continues to perform strongly in institutional capital flows
Ethereum has recently shown stronger momentum among institutional investors. The latest inflow of $70.48 million is based on several consecutive days of positive demand, indicating that despite continued market volatility, investor acceptance of Ethereum exposure is gradually increasing.
Market participants point to Ethereum\'s expanding role in areas such as tokenization, decentralized finance, and institutional blockchain infrastructure as a factor supporting its demand. At the same time, a number of asset management companies continue to increase their focus on Ethereum-related investment products, which also helps maintain capital inflows, even though the flow of funds from Bitcoin funds remains volatile.
Bitcoin remains sensitive to macroeconomic developments. Investors continue to focus on interest rate expectations, global geopolitical risks and overall risk appetite, which have together contributed to the instability of Bitcoin ETF funds in recent weeks.
Bitcoin and Ethereum ETF fund flows remain key market indicators.
Spot ETF activity has become one of the clearest measures of institutions \'sentiment towards digital assets. Strong inflows usually mean increased confidence among professional investors, while sustained outflows often reflect a more defensive stance.
Although the Bitcoin ETF has encountered another redemption, the outflow is relatively small compared to previous weeks, which may indicate that selling pressure is stabilizing rather than intensifying. At the same time, Ethereum\'s five-day inflow shows that capital is selectively shifting to assets that investors believe have stronger opportunities in the short term.
With the Bitcoin trading price hovering around US$62000 and market conditions highly sensitive to economic developments, it is expected that in the next few weeks, ETF capital flow data will remain a measure of institutions \'participation in the crypto market. One of the most watched indicators.
